Skin pigmentation problems are quite common and can be caused by factors like sun exposure, hormonal changes, acne scars, genetics, or ageing. Some people experience dark spots, uneven skin tone, melasma, or hyperpigmentation on areas like the face, neck, and hands.
To manage pigmentation, many dermatologists recommend:
✅ Daily sunscreen to prevent worsening
✅ Topical creams with Vitamin C, retinol, kojic acid, or hydroquinone
✅ Chemical peels to exfoliate and lighten spots
✅ Laser treatment for deeper pigmentation issues
✅ Professional skin analysis to find the root cause
